Liz Towns-Andrews Inaugural lecture

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

The department of Research and Enterprise is proud to announce the Professorial Inaugural Lecture of Professor Liz Towns-Andrews, Director of Research and Enterprise and the 3M Professor of Innovation at the University.

A trained chemist, Liz graduated with a PhD in X-ray crystallography before joining the Research Council system.  She also has an MBA and is a Fellow of the Institute of Physics. Read more on Liz here
